titleOfInvention | Centrifugal supergravity directional casting system with partition heating function |
abstract | The utility model discloses a directional founding system of centrifugal hypergravity with subregion heating function. Comprises a hanging cup, a heating device, a crucible device and a heat preservation device; a heat preservation device is arranged in the hanging cup, a heating device is arranged in the heat preservation device, a crucible device is arranged in the heating device, lifting lugs are arranged on two sides of the top of the hanging cup, and the hanging cup is hinged and hung on the end part of a rotating arm of the supergravity centrifugal machine through the lifting lugs on the two sides; according to the alloy type, the material types of the upper heating body, the lower heating body and the crucible are determined, a system is installed and built, a ground power supply system is connected, a centrifugal machine is used for dynamic balance test, and directional solidification is carried out. The utility model discloses possess and utilize the power reduction method to realize the directional solidification function of hypergravity, solved the difficult key difficult problem of control of temperature gradient in the directional solidification process of hypergravity, cooling rate and temperature gradient are adjustable controllable, and the structure is inseparable, and the security is high. |
